From e23156e87bd32206a5ea529fbecc04fdf37d7bc2 Mon Sep 17 00:00:00 2001 From: Joshua Peek Date: Sat, 19 Jul 2008 12:35:42 -0500 Subject: Only create a path for ActionMailer template root instead of a path set. Better fix than 7461227 --- actionmailer/lib/action_mailer/base.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'actionmailer/lib') diff --git a/actionmailer/lib/action_mailer/base.rb b/actionmailer/lib/action_mailer/base.rb index e4920f0c86..bf60e2f3d5 100644 --- a/actionmailer/lib/action_mailer/base.rb +++ b/actionmailer/lib/action_mailer/base.rb @@ -426,7 +426,7 @@ module ActionMailer #:nodoc: end def template_root=(root) - write_inheritable_attribute(:template_root, ActionView::PathSet.new(Array(root))) + write_inheritable_attribute(:template_root, ActionView::PathSet::Path.new(root)) end end @@ -541,7 +541,7 @@ module ActionMailer #:nodoc: end def template_path - "#{template_root.join}/#{mailer_name}" + "#{template_root}/#{mailer_name}" end def initialize_template_class(assigns) -- cgit v1.2.3